Common Questions People Are Asking

  • What does it mean to speak truthfully?
    Speaking truthfully means communicating your thoughts and feelings honestly while respecting the context and audience. It involves avoiding assumptions and seeking understanding before reacting.
  • How can I start practicing this approach?
    Begin by identifying situations where you feel strongly about an issue. Pause to reflect on your motivations, then express yourself calmly and directly. Practice active listening to ensure mutual respect.
  • Is this relevant for workplaces or schools?
    Absolutely. Many organizations are adopting frameworks that encourage open communication paired with emotional intelligence. These strategies help reduce misunderstandings and build stronger teams.
  • Can it improve relationships?
    Yes. When people feel heard and respected, trust increases. Honest yet compassionate dialogue often leads to healthier boundaries and more satisfying connections.
  • What if someone reacts negatively?
    Remaining composed and empathetic can de-escalate tension. Acknowledge differing viewpoints without dismissing them, and focus on shared goals.
